RECORD SELECTOR This rotary switch allows recording of any of the six different inputs available on the back panel. Note that when recording, the source that is being listened to will not be interfered with. For example, it is possible to be listening to the CD input whilst recording from the TUNER input. TAPE OUTPUTS These RCA outputs are situated next to the tape RCA inputs, and are provided to interface to a pair of line level recording devices. The position of the record selector on the front panel determines from which device a recording is being made. As these tape outputs are always ‘live’, both can be used to record the chosen signal at any time. PLACEMENT AND VENTILATION Your Plinius 8100 operates at a moderately high temperature, especially when being driven hard. The ideal location is upon a rigid stand, or floor mounted away from direct contact with any temperature sensitive materials or deep pile carpets. Ventilation through and around the amplifier should also be kept unimpeded, so ensure that the heat vents (slots in the lid and base) are not covered or restricted in any way. REMOTE CONTROL Provided with your Plinius 8100 is a three function remote control. The two buttons at the top of the remote adjust the volume level, and the button below switches the amplifier in and out of mute. Two AAA batteries power the remote, and these are replaced by removing the two posi-drive screws holding the bottom plate in place. The rear panel of the remote can now be slid downwards. MAINS/LINE FUSE A Mains/Line fuse is fitted within the IEC socket on the rear of the amplifier. A small drawer at the bottom of this socket may be removed (after the IEC plug is removed) by levering it out with a flat blade screwdriver. The fuse fitted should be rated at no greater than 5 amps slow blow. IMPORTANT: DO NOT FIT A FUSE WITH A HIGHER RATING.
